Business Development Director - Biotech supports top management by providing analysis for evaluating new business opportunities such as in/out licensing, collaborative research and development agreements, joint ventures, mergers and acquisitions. Oversees business development activities through subordinate managers. Being a Business Development Director - Biotech requires an MBA and at least 5 years of experience in the field or in a related area. Familiar with a variety of the field's concepts, practices, and procedures. Additionally, Business Development Director - Biotech relies on extensive experience and judgment to plan and accomplish goals. Performs a variety of tasks. Leads and directs the work of others. A wide degree of creativity and latitude is expected. Typically reports to top management.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
